Separating Mixtures
混合物分离
Description
Use knowledge of solids, liquids, and gases to decide how mixtures might be separated through filtering, sieving, and evaporating
Mastery Evidence
- Choose the correct separation method for a given mixture (sieving for large particles, filtering for small, evaporating for dissolved)
- Describe a multi-step separation plan for a complex mixture like sand, salt, and water
- Explain why each method works based on the properties of the materials
Assessment Prompt
If your child has a mixture of sand, salt, and water, can they figure out a step-by-step plan to separate all three using a sieve, filter, and evaporation?
